Top 7 Tools in My Fix-It Arsenal
- The Trusty Hammer - because sometimes, you just need a little brute force.
- A Level - because no one appreciates wonky towel bars.
- An Adjustable Wrench - a true one-size-fits-all miracle worker.
- A Power Drill - for when manual effort just doesn’t cut it.
- A Stud Finder - because playing hide and seek with studs isn’t as fun as it sounds.
- Plumbing Tape - the unsung hero for leak prevention.
- LED Headlamp - because what’s worse than fixing a sink in the dark?
With these in hand, I’m ready to tackle just about anything that a home might throw at me.
